Summary
This 8-K filing from Exelon Corporation, dated July 31, 2006, primarily serves to attach a revised presentation of "2007 around-the-clock historical forward prices" discussed during their second quarter earnings and merger update conference call. Investors should note that this specific filing, under Item 9.01, is furnished and not formally filed with the SEC, meaning it's for informational purposes regarding the attached exhibit rather than a report of material events. The core information provided is the updated forward price slide, which is crucial for understanding Exelon's expectations regarding future energy prices that could impact its financial performance.
